Sat 1851810362785181

decimal
652896.362785181
degree
0°22896′1728″362785181‴
percentile
88.18144594391302%
name
asrluqxpdnw
cycle
0
epoch
3
period
323
block
652896
offset
362785181
timestamp
rarity
common